如何查看服务器的mysql 状态
-
要查看服务器的MySQL状态,可以使用以下几种方法:
-
使用 MySQL自带的命令行工具:在命令行中输入 "mysql" ,然后使用有效的用户名和密码登录到MySQL。登录成功后,可以使用命令 "SHOW STATUS" 来查看MySQL服务器的状态信息。这将显示一系列包含有关服务器性能和运行状况的变量和其当前值。
-
使用MySQL的监控工具:MySQL提供了一些监控工具,例如 MySQL Workbench 和 phpMyAdmin等。这些工具可以通过简单的图形界面来查看服务器的状态信息。可以从MySQL官方网站下载工具,然后按照安装指南进行安装和配置。
-
使用命令行工具:可以使用Linux或Windows操作系统的命令行工具来查看MySQL的状态。在命令提示符下,输入 "mysqladmin -u [用户名] -p status" 来查看服务器状态。系统将提示输入密码,输入密码后,将会显示服务器的状态信息。
-
使用第三方工具:还可以使用第三方工具来监控MySQL服务器的状态。例如,有一些开源的工具(如Nagios和Cacti),可以提供详细的服务器性能和运行状况报告。可以根据具体需求选择合适的工具,并按照其文档进行安装和配置。
-
查看MySQL的日志文件:MySQL服务器会生成不同类型的日志文件,其中包含有关服务器运行状况和事件的详细信息。可以通过查看这些日志文件来获得MySQL服务器的状态。根据MySQL的配置,日志文件可以位于不同的位置,可以在配置文件中查找日志文件的位置,然后使用文本编辑器打开并查看文件内容。
总结起来,要查看服务器的MySQL状态,可以使用MySQL自带的命令行工具、MySQL的监控工具、命令行工具、第三方工具和查看MySQL的日志文件。这些方法可以提供有关服务器的性能和运行状况的详细信息,有助于监控和优化MySQL服务器的性能。
1年前 -
-
要查看服务器的MySQL状态,你可以使用以下几种方法:
-
使用MySQL内置的命令行工具:登录到服务器的命令行终端,使用以下命令登录到MySQL服务器:
mysql -u <用户名> -p这将提示你输入密码,输入密码后,你将登录到MySQL服务器的命令行界面。然后可以使用以下命令来查看MySQL状态:
SHOW STATUS;这将显示MySQL服务器的各种状态信息,包括连接数、查询数、缓存命中率等。
-
使用MySQL的监控工具:MySQL提供了一些监控工具,比如MySQL Workbench和phpMyAdmin等。你可以使用这些工具连接到MySQL服务器,并通过界面来查看服务器的状态信息。
以MySQL Workbench为例,打开MySQL Workbench,并连接到MySQL服务器。在连接后,你将看到一个“SERVER STATUS”标签,点击它将显示服务器的各种状态信息。
-
使用系统监控工具:你还可以使用系统监控工具来查看服务器的MySQL状态。不同操作系统有不同的工具,比如Linux上的top命令和Windows上的任务管理器等。
在Linux上,你可以使用以下命令来查看MySQL进程的状态:
top -p `pgrep mysql`这将显示MySQL进程的实时状态,包括CPU使用率、内存使用量等。
在Windows上,你可以通过打开任务管理器,切换到“进程”选项卡,并查找名为“mysqld.exe”的进程来查看MySQL进程的状态。
以上是几种常见的查看服务器MySQL状态的方法,你可以根据需要选择其中一种来查看服务器的MySQL状态。
1年前 -
-
要查看服务器的 MySQL 状态,可以通过以下几种方法:
-
使用 MySQL 自带的命令行工具:在服务器上打开终端或命令提示符窗口,输入以下命令:
mysqladmin -uroot -p status这将提示您输入 MySQL 的 root 用户的密码,输入密码后,将输出包含有关服务器状态的信息,如下所示:
Uptime: 12345 Threads: 10 Questions: 1000 Slow queries: 5 Opens: 20 Flush tables: 1 Open tables: 10 Queries per second avg: 0.5在这个示例中,您可以看到服务器的运行时间(Uptime),活动连接数(Threads),执行的查询数(Questions),缓慢查询数(Slow queries),打开的表数(Opens),刷新表数(Flush tables),打开的表数(Open tables)和平均每秒查询数(Queries per second avg)等信息。
-
使用 MySQL 的系统视图和表:连接到 MySQL 服务器,运行以下命令查询信息:
SELECT * FROM information_schema.global_status;这将返回一个包含有关服务器全局状态的表格,如下所示:
+--------------------------+-------+ | Variable_name | Value | +--------------------------+-------+ | Bytes_received | 12345 | | Bytes_sent | 67890 | | Com_commit | 10 | | Com_select | 100 | | Com_insert | 50 | | Com_update | 20 | | Com_delete | 5 | | Questions | 1000 | | Threads_connected | 10 | | Uptime | 12345 | +--------------------------+-------+可以根据需要选择特定的变量来查看相关的信息。
-
使用 MySQL 的性能监控工具:MySQL 提供了一些工具和插件来监控服务器的状态。其中包括性能监视器(Performance Schema),它允许您收集有关服务器性能的详细信息。
要启用性能监视器,您需要在 MySQL 配置文件中进行一些设置。打开配置文件(通常是 my.cnf 或 my.ini),找到并取消注释以下行:
performance_schema = ON保存并关闭配置文件后,重新启动 MySQL 服务器。
然后,您可以使用 PERFORMANCE_SCHEMA 表查询性能监视器信息。以下是一个示例查询:
SELECT * FROM performance_schema.global_status;这将返回一个包含有关服务器全局状态的表格,类似于第二种方法中所示的表格。
以上是查看服务器的 MySQL 状态的几种常见方法。您可以根据自己的需求和环境选择最适合您的方法。
1年前 -